Kontrollera LED med HC-05 Bluetooth-modul och Arduino

Artikelns innehåll
  1. Kontrollera LED med HC-05 Bluetooth-modul och Arduino
  2. Introduktion
  3. Vad är HC-05 Bluetooth-modul?
  4. Komponenter som behövs
  5. Kopplingsschema
  6. Programmera Arduino
  7. Kontrollera LED via Bluetooth
  8. Felsökning och tips
  9. Avslutning

Kontrollera LED med HC-05 Bluetooth-modul och Arduino

Att styra LED-lampor via Bluetooth med hjälp av en HC-05 Bluetooth-modul och Arduino kan öppna dörrar till en mängd olika projekt inom hemautomation och teknik. Genom denna artikel kommer vi att detaljera hur du kan implementera en bluetooth modul arduino för att kontrollera LED-lampor på ett enkelt sätt. Oavsett om du är en nybörjare eller en erfaren hobbyist kommer du att hitta tillräckligt med information, steg-för-steg-instruktioner, och tips för att lyckas med ditt projekt.

Denna praktiska lösning bygger på kombinationen av arduino bluetooth modul och hc-05 bluetooth modul. Genom att använda en bluetooth modul för arduino och programmera din arduino kan du fjärrstyra LED-lampor via en mobiltelefon eller annan enhet som stödjer Bluetooth. Läs vidare för att få en djupare förståelse för komponenterna, kopplingsschemat, programmeringen, och även felsökningstips.

Introduktion

Denna artikel är utformad för att ge dig en grundlig förståelse av hur du kan använda HC-05 Bluetooth-modul tillsammans med en Arduino för att styra en LED-lampa. Bluetooth-teknologin integreras smidigt med Arduino, vilket gör det легко att fjärrstyra olika komponenter. Genom att förstå grunderna i hur bluetooth med arduino fungerar, kommer du att kunna ta dina projekt till nästa nivå.

Med en bluetooth modul hc-05 får du en pålitlig och lättanvänd lösning för att kommunicera med din Arduino. Denna modul är populär bland hobbyister och ingenjörer för dess mångsidighet och användarvänlighet. Oavsett om du vill ha en enkel fjärrkontroll för din LED-lampa, eller bygga mer komplexa system, är detta projekt en utmärkt utgångspunkt.

Vad är HC-05 Bluetooth-modul?

HC-05 Bluetooth-modul är en kraftfull och mångsidig modul som gör det möjligt för enheter att kommunicera trådlöst över korta avstånd. Modulen kan anslutas till en Arduino för att skapa en trådlös kommunikationslänk, vilket gör det möjligt att styra olika enheter. Den fungerar med både Arduino Uno och andra Arduino-kort, vilket gör den extremt flexibel att använda.

See also  Installera Docker Dashboard: Heimdall med Docker och Compose

HC-05-modulen är en bluetooth modul arduino designad för seriell kommunikation. Den har flera användbara funktioner, inklusive en enkel konfigurering och möjligheten att växla mellan master- och slavläge. Det är detta som gör att du enkelt kan koppla din arduino till andra enheter och styra dem via en app eller mobiltelefon.

Komponenter som behövs

För detta projekt kommer du att behöva följande komponenter:

  • Arduino Uno
  • HC-05 Bluetooth-modul
  • LED-lampa
  • Motstånd (330 ohm, valfritt)
  • Brödbräda och kopplingskablar

Den största komponenten i detta projekt är arduino bluetooth modulen, HC-05, som möjliggör trådlös kommunikation. För LED-lampan kan du använda en vanlig LED eller en RGB-lampa om du vill ha färgkontroll. Om du använder ett motstånd för att skydda LED-lampan, tänk på att du kan ansluta den direkt utan motstånd, men det är rekommenderat att alltid ha ett motstånd för att förhindra överström.

Kopplingsschema

När du kopplar samman komponenterna, följer här hur du ska gå tillväga:

  1. Anslut HC-05 Bluetooth-modul till Arduino enligt följande:
    • VCC till 5V på Arduino
    • GND till GND på Arduino
    • TX till pin 10 på Arduino
    • RX till pin 11 via ett motstånd
  2. Anslut LED-lampan:
    • Den korta benet (katod) till GND
    • Den långa benet (anod) till pin 9 på Arduino via ett motstånd om det används.

Säkerställ att alla anslutningar är korrekta innan du fortsätter. Det är viktigt att vara noggrann med kopplingarna för att undvika skador på komponenterna.

Programmera Arduino

Nu när du har kopplat alla komponenter, är det dags att skriva koden som kommer att styra din LED-lampa via Bluetooth. Här är ett exempel på programmet som du kan använda:


#include 

SoftwareSerial BTSerial(10, 11); // RX, TX

int ledPin = 9;
char command;

void setup() {
  BTSerial.begin(9600);
  pinMode(ledPin, OUTPUT);
}

void loop() {
  if (BTSerial.available()) {
    command = BTSerial.read();
    
    if (command == '1') {
      digitalWrite(ledPin, HIGH); // Tända LED
    } 
    else if (command == '0') {
      digitalWrite(ledPin, LOW); // Släcka LED
    }
  }
}

Denna kod använder SoftwareSerial för att kommunicera med HC-05 Bluetooth-modulen. Genom att skicka '1' kommer LED-lampan att tändas, och genom att skicka '0' kommer den att släckas. Se till att kompilera och ladda upp koden till din Arduino.

Kontrollera LED via Bluetooth

När du har laddat upp programmet kan du nu använda en app på din mobiltelefon för att skicka kommandon till din Arduino. Det finns flera appar tillgängliga för både Android och iOS som kan användas för att styra din bluetooth modul arduino. En populär app är Bluetooth Terminal, som enkelt låter dig skicka textkommandon till din HC-05 modul bluetooth.

För att styra din LED, öppna appen, anslut till din HC-05 bluetooth modul, och skriv '1' för att tända LED-lampan och '0' för att släcka den. Du bör se att LED-lampan svarar på dina kommandon direkt.

Felsökning och tips

Om du stöter på problem under uppsättningen, här är några felsökningstips och vanliga problem:

  • Kontrollera anslutningar: Se till att alla ledningar är korrekt anslutna och att det inte finns några lösa kopplingar.
  • Besök Bluetooth-inställningarna: Se till att HC-05 är korrekt kopplad till din mobiltelefon.
  • Testa med en annan app: Om en app inte fungerar, prova med en annan Bluetooth-terminal.
  • Kontrollera strömförsörjningen: Se till att modulen får tillräckligt med spänning och att Arduino är korrekt strömad.

Genom att följa dessa tips kan du oftast identifiera och lösa eventuella problem. Kom ihåg att experimentera och ha kul med dina arduino and bluetooth projekt.

Avslutning

I denna artikel har vi gått igenom hela processen för att styra en LED-lampa med hjälp av en HC-05 Bluetooth-modul och Arduino. Från att koppla ihop alla komponenter till att programmera din Arduino och styra LED-lampan via Bluetooth, har vi sett hur enkelt och roligt det kan vara att integrera bluetooth med arduino. Oavsett om du är nybörjare eller erfaren, kan detta projekt ge en solid grund för vidare experimentering och inlärning.

Kontrollera LED med HC-05 Bluetooth-modul och Arduino är ett perfekt sätt att introducera trådlös teknik i dina projekt. Vi hoppas att du nu känner dig inspirerad att fortsätta med dina egna arduino bluetooth projekt och kanske skapa ännu mer interaktiva och intressanta lösningar med hjälp av den mångsidiga HC-05 bluetooth modul arduino.

Tack för att du läste vår artikel, du kan se alla artiklar i våra webbkartor eller i Sitemaps

Tyckte du att den här artikeln var användbar? Kontrollera LED med HC-05 Bluetooth-modul och Arduino Du kan se mer här NanoPi.

Niklas Andersson

Niklas Andersson

Hej, jag heter Niklas Andersson och är en passionerad student på civilingenjörsprogrammet i elektronik och en entusiastisk bloggare. Redan som liten har jag varit nyfiken på hur elektroniska apparater fungerar och hur tekniken kan förändra våra liv. Denna nyfikenhet ledde till att jag började studera elektronikkonstruktion, där jag varje dag utforskar nya idéer, konstruktioner och innovativa lösningar.

Tack för att du läser innehållet i Maker Electronics

Se mer relaterat innehåll

Leave a Reply

Your email address will not be published. Required fields are marked *

Your score: Useful

Go up